Preparation Procedure of Liquid Microcapsules

After determining the appropriate wall and core materials, other factors must be considered such as the particle sizes of the prepared microcapsules and their stabilities in plating baths thus, a suitable process is essential when preparing specific microcapsules. [Pg.305]

In addition to the nature of surfactants, other factors such as the ratio of core to wall material components, the surfactant quantity, the feeding order and preparation time also affect the stability and particle size of microcapsules. [Pg.307]

The addition of anhydrous alcohol may result in two phases one phase will contain more gelatin than the other, and this leads to an enhanced wall macromolecu-lar interaction and the formation of insoluble polymer aggregates that encapsulate the homogenously dispersed core material. [Pg.307]
